Unlocking Cannabis Synergy: The Power of CBD and THC Together

When it comes to the world of cannabis, there’s a fascinating synergy between CBD and THC that deserves attention. While many people are drawn to CBD for its non-psychoactive benefits, there’s compelling evidence that a little THC can enhance these effects without necessarily inducing a high.

The key to understanding this dynamic lies in the concept of the “entourage effect.” This is the theory that cannabinoids work better together than they do alone. While CBD on its own can offer numerous benefits like reducing anxiety, alleviating pain, and improving sleep, adding a small amount of THC into the mix can amplify these effects. It’s like having a band where each instrument plays its part; when they all come together, the music is richer and more harmonious.

For those who are hesitant about experiencing any psychoactive effects, it’s important to note that you don’t need much THC to experience these enhanced benefits. Even products with low levels of THC can contribute significantly to the overall therapeutic impact. Definition:


Cannabis Synergy: The enhanced effect achieved when CBD and THC are used together, compared to their effects when used separately.

CBD (Cannabidiol): A non-psychoactive compound found in cannabis that is known for its potential therapeutic benefits.

THC (Tetrahydrocannabinol): The psychoactive compound in cannabis responsible for the “high” sensation.
